我是R语言的初学者。我已经学习了如何检查数字数据之间的相关性。

但是,我找不到有关如何检查数字和布尔数据类型之间的相关性的详细信息。有人可以给我提示或指导我吗?

提前致谢!

最佳答案

我想您正在寻找point-biserial correlation。下载包ltm。它包括函数biserial.cor

x <- rnorm(10)
y <- rep(c(0,1), 5)

library(ltm)
biserial.cor(x,y)
#[1] -0.08279833

有关详细信息,请参见?biserial.cor

结果与内置cor函数获得的结果略有不同:
cor(x,y)
#[1] 0.0872771

关于r - 检查R中数字和 bool 值之间的相关性,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/12496183/

10-08 22:36